We may earn an affiliate commission when you visit our partners.
NAOKI MATSUMOTO

この講座の目標は、ITに関する基礎的な知識を身に着けることと、基本情報技術者試験と応用情報技術者試験の各分野について勉強して、過去問を通じた演習をして、試験合格水準の知識を身に着けることです。

以下の4つの項目からなっています

  • 基本情報技術者試験・応用情報技術者両方の午前問題の対策をして合格水準の知識を身に着けること。

  • 基本情報技術者試験の午後問題の対策とプログラミング問題の対策としてPythonを覚えること。

  • 応用情報技術者の午後問題の対策をすること

  • 講師独自の経験を元にしたボーナスの講座

講師独自の経験を元にしたボーナスの講座は以下の内容を考えています

  • SQL

  • Python

    基本文法

    関数

    クラス、継承

    パッケージ管理、標準ライブラリ(date, datetime, decimal)

    新機能 python 3.8 セイウチ演算子

  • ITシステムの構成

  • ITシステムの性能

  • AI/ディープラーニング

Read more

この講座の目標は、ITに関する基礎的な知識を身に着けることと、基本情報技術者試験と応用情報技術者試験の各分野について勉強して、過去問を通じた演習をして、試験合格水準の知識を身に着けることです。

以下の4つの項目からなっています

  • 基本情報技術者試験・応用情報技術者両方の午前問題の対策をして合格水準の知識を身に着けること。

  • 基本情報技術者試験の午後問題の対策とプログラミング問題の対策としてPythonを覚えること。

  • 応用情報技術者の午後問題の対策をすること

  • 講師独自の経験を元にしたボーナスの講座

講師独自の経験を元にしたボーナスの講座は以下の内容を考えています

  • SQL

  • Python

    基本文法

    関数

    クラス、継承

    パッケージ管理、標準ライブラリ(date, datetime, decimal)

    新機能 python 3.8 セイウチ演算子

  • ITシステムの構成

  • ITシステムの性能

  • AI/ディープラーニング

講座は試験のシラバスに沿って以下の通り行います

1. 基本情報・応用情報の午前問題対策

2. 基本情報の午後問題対策

3. 応用情報の午後問題対策

ボーナス1. Python講座

ボーナス2. SQL対策講座(2020/06完成予定)

Enroll now

What's inside

Learning objectives

  • 企業の経営戦略、マーケティング、財務、技術戦略、システム戦略に関する知見
  • システムの開発技術、プロジェクトマネジメント、サービスマネジメント、システム監査に関する知見
  • Itのテクノロジーに関する知識、アルゴリズム、コンピュータアーキテクチャ、データベース、ネットワーク、セキュリティ関する知見
  • Ai, iot, ビッグデータなどの最新の分野の知識
  • Pythonについて詳細な文法を用いたプログラミング(ボーナスコンテンツ)
  • Sqlについて基礎的な内容(ボーナスコンテンツ)
  • システムの基礎的な内容、システムの性能などシステム開発で必須となる要素(ボーナスコンテンツ)

Syllabus

はじめに
この講座の目的について
各セクションの内容
午前問題の基礎理論について理解して問題を解けるようになること
Read more
このセクションで勉強すること
離散数学~その1~
離散数学~その2~
離散数学~その3~
離散数学~過去問~

ここでは、離散数学で用いた演習問題を実施します。


是非、復習にお使いください

応用数学~その1~
応用数学~その2~
応用数学~その3~
応用数学~過去問~

ここでは、応用数学で用いた演習問題を実施します。


是非、復習にお使いください

情報に関する理論~その1~
情報に関する理論~その2~
情報に関する理論~その3~
情報に関する理論~過去問~

ここでは、情報に関する理論で用いた演習問題を実施します。


是非、復習にお使いください

通信に関する理論
通信に関する理論~過去問~

ここでは、通信に関する理論で用いた演習問題を実施します。


是非、復習にお使いください

計測・制御に関する理論
計測・制御に関する理論~過去問~

ここでは、計測・制御に関する理論で用いた演習問題を実施します。


是非、復習にお使いください

データ構造
データ構造~過去問~

ここでは、データ構造に関する理論で用いた演習問題を実施します。


是非、復習にお使いください

アルゴリズム、前半
アルゴリズム、後半
アルゴリズム~テスト~

ここでは、アルゴリズムに関する理論で用いた演習問題を実施します。


是非、復習にお使いください

プログラミング
プログラミング~テスト~

ここでは、プログラミングに関する理論で用いた演習問題を実施します。


是非、復習にお使いください

プログラム言語
プログラム言語~過去問~

ここでは、プログラム言語で用いた演習問題を実施します。


是非、復習にお使いください

その他の言語
その他の言語~過去問~

その他の言語に関する復習として小テストを作成しました。


Pythonで開発するための環境の構築ができるようになります
このセクションについて
Pythonの仮想環境とは何か
Windows: venvのインストールと環境構築
Windows: Minicondaのインストールと環境構築
Windows: VSCodeのインストールと環境構築
Windows: Python(venv)のアンインストール手順
Windows: Minicondaのアンインストール手順
Mac: venvのインストールと環境構築
Mac: Minicondaのインストールと環境構築
Mac: VSCodeのインストールと環境構築
Mac: Python(venv)のアンインストール手順
Mac: Minicondaのアンインストール手順
共通: 「pip install」と「conda install」について
おまけ: VSCodeの設定編集方法
おまけ: 拡張機能
おまけ: ショートカット一覧
Python開発を自立してできるようになること

Python

  • 標準出力・入力の使い方

  • コメント文の使い方

  • 変数の使い方

について勉強して、知識を身に着けます。

Python

  • 定数の使い方

について身につきます

Pythonの

  • 論理型(True, False)

の使い方が身につきます

Pythonの

  • 数値型(int)

  • 浮動小数点型(float)

  • 数値演算(四則演算)

の使い方が身につきます

整数型、浮動小数点数型、数値演算、ビット演算、シフト演算2~基本講座1~

Pythonの

  • 2進数, 8進数, 16進数の変換

の使い方について身につきます。

Pythonの

  • 複素数型

の使い方について身につきます

Pythonの

  • 文字列型の基本的な使い方

について身につきます

Pythonの

  • 文字列型の関数の使い方

について身につきます

Pythonの

  • 文字列型、数値型変換

について身につきます

Pythonの

  • リスト型の使い方

について身につきます

Pythonの

  • リスト型の関数の使い方

について身につきます

リスト3~基本講座1~

Pythonの

  • 辞書型の使い方

について身につきます

Pythonの

  • 辞書型の関数の使い方

について身につきます

Pythonの

  • タプル型の使い方

について身につきます

Pythonの

  • セット型の使い方

について身につきます

Pythonの

  • セット型の関数の使い方

について身につきます

Pythonの

  • データ構造の使い方

について演習を通じて実践的な知識が身につきます

Pythonのデータ構造についてのまとめです

Pythonの

  • if文

  • if, elif, else

  • and, or

の使い方について身につきます

Pythonの

  • all, any

の使い方について身につきます

Pythonの

  • if, elif, else

を用いて演習を行い、実践的な知識を身に着けます

Pythonの

  • forループ文, range

についての知識が身につきます

Pythonの

  • forループ文

  • enemurate, zip関数

  • whileループ文

についての知識が身につきます

Pythonの

  • forループ文、whileループ文

  • continue, break

についての知識が身につきます

Python3.8追加機能の

  • セイウチ演算子

についての知識が身につきます

Pythonの

ループ文を用いた演習を行い、実践的な知識を身に着けます

Pythonの例外処理

  • try句

  • Exception

の使い方について身につきます

Pythonの例外処理

  • try句

  • except

  • else

  • finally

についての知識が身につきます。

Pythonの例外処理

  • try句

  • 例外クラスの作成

  • raise

についての使い方が身につきます

Pythonのアルゴリズムを用いた演習

  • 選択ソート

について勉強します

Pythonのアルゴリズムを用いた演習

  • バブルソート

について勉強します

Pythonの

  • 関数

  • 型の指定

について勉強します

Save this course

Save 【2024】基本情報技術者試験+応用情報技術者試験+Python+SQL 初心者からプロのエンジニアになる講座 to your list so you can find it easily later:
Save

Activities

Coming soon We're preparing activities for 【2024】基本情報技術者試験+応用情報技術者試験+Python+SQL 初心者からプロのエンジニアになる講座. These are activities you can do either before, during, or after a course.

Career center

Learners who complete 【2024】基本情報技術者試験+応用情報技術者試験+Python+SQL 初心者からプロのエンジニアになる講座 will develop knowledge and skills that may be useful to these careers:

Reading list

We haven't picked any books for this reading list yet.
Practical guide to using Python for basic automation tasks, providing a gentle introduction to Python's core concepts and its practical applications.
Comprehensive guide to the basics of Python programming, covering data types, control flow, functions, object-oriented programming, and debugging.
Comprehensive guide to deep learning using Python, covering neural networks, convolutional neural networks, and recurrent neural networks.
Concise and comprehensive reference to the Python language, covering syntax, built-in functions and objects, and advanced topics.
Comprehensive guide to the Python Standard Library, covering its vast collection of modules and their applications.
Practical guide to testing Python code using the pytest framework, covering unit testing, integration testing, and end-to-end testing.
Practical guide to using Python for bioinformatics tasks, covering sequence analysis, genome assembly, and data visualization.
Comprehensive guide to using Python for financial analysis and modeling, covering data manipulation, financial calculations, and visualization.
This comprehensive guide covers all aspects of SQL, from basic concepts to advanced techniques. It is especially relevant for individuals seeking a thorough understanding of SQL for data analysis and reporting.
Using a unique and engaging approach, this book introduces SQL concepts through real-world examples and hands-on exercises. It is suitable for beginners seeking a practical understanding of SQL.
Written in a clear and concise style, this book provides a step-by-step guide to writing effective SQL queries. It is particularly helpful for beginners who want to master the basics of SQL.
This practical guide offers a collection of ready-to-use SQL recipes for various data manipulation and analysis tasks. It is valuable for experienced SQL users who want to expand their knowledge and solve specific problems.
This specialized book focuses on the critical topic of SQL injection attacks and defense mechanisms. It is relevant for individuals concerned with data security and protecting databases from malicious attacks.
This user-friendly guide introduces SQL concepts in a simplified and accessible manner. It is suitable for absolute beginners who want to gain a basic understanding of SQL.

Share

Help others find this course page by sharing it with your friends and followers:

Similar courses

Similar courses are unavailable at this time. Please try again later.
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2025 OpenCourser